The Paramedic Science - Integrated Masters (MSci) at Keele University is designed for aspiring healthcare professionals ready to tackle the dynamic challenges of frontline emergency and urgent care. You will develop the critical thinking, resilience, and advanced competencies required to deliver high-quality patient care across diverse settings. This programme, grounded in the multidisciplinary approach of Keele's School of Medicine, prepares you for a vital role in modern healthcare by focusing on fundamental life sciences, applied paramedic practice, and evidence-based research.
This full-time, on-campus integrated masters is studied over four years, providing a comprehensive and progressive learning experience. You will engage with modules covering applied anatomy, pharmacology, public health, and critical care, alongside extensive practical simulation and applied paramedic practice. In your final year, you will undertake an Advancing Practice Project, consolidating your learning and preparing you for advanced roles. You will graduate with the skills and knowledge to excel as a paramedic, ready to lead and innovate within the healthcare sector.
